What you pay

$28,384/ yr

Average net price after grants & scholarships — about $113,536 over four years.

What grads earn

$62,575/ yr

Median earnings 4 years after completion$67,449 adjusted to national cost of living (local prices 7% below average).

A graduate’s first-year earnings cover the four-year net cost in roughly 1.8 years of pay.

77% of students out-earn a typical high-school graduate (about $28,500) within 10 years.

Economic mobility

Access

2.8%

from the bottom income fifth

Success

28%

of them reach the top fifth

Mobility rate

0.8%

move bottom → top

The mobility rate is how many of Miami University-Oxford’s students both start in the bottom income fifth and reach the top — a measure of who the school lifts, not just who it admits.

Net price by family income

Under $30k$16,015
$30–48k$18,193
$48–75k$23,806
$75–110k$29,048
Over $110k$31,431

Average net price paid by federally-aided students, by family income bracket.
